| Parameter | Typical Range | Unit |
|---|---|---|
| Operating Pressure | 1.0 – 25 | bar (gauge) |
| Temperature Rating | -20 – 350 | °C |
| Flow Coefficient (Cv) | 0.5 – 250 | — |
| Actuator Type | Pneumatic diaphragm | — |
| Material of Construction | SS304, SS316L, Hastelloy® C-276 | — |
| Connection Type | Flanged, Threaded, Butt‑weld | — |
| Control Signal | 4‑20 mA, 0‑10 V (optional) | — |
| Cycle Rating | 10 – 30 cps | cycles/min |
